Transaction 0513ca2120f0c88e6f022d8c79d72537f4be79c238f84f5e79ee11abcdde44e6

6 Input
2 Outputs
  • 0513ca2120f0c88e6f022d8c79d72537f4be79c238f84f5e79ee11abcdde44e6:0
  • value  512286361
    address  323vsZXsDqpy2HpgAmmNS3ZvHN9jBfbpxc
  • 0513ca2120f0c88e6f022d8c79d72537f4be79c238f84f5e79ee11abcdde44e6:1
  • value  155888450
    address  1HgcjDJEwe6KBTnEoXURL6UNscdpw9Vehm